Job Description - Junior Business Architect

About Charter:


Founded in 1997, Victoria headquartered Charter has grown into one of Canada’s foremost fastest growing Information Technology providers in the country, providing a broad array of high value product and service solutions to clients operating some of the most mission critical networks and applications.



If you are looking to be an integral part of a vibrant, success-based environment with the core values of empowerment, flexibility, agility, innovation, high knowledge based, life balanced, and high ethics deeply embedded into the everyday culture then Charter is a place for you to look.  We are a high energy business focused team, providing the highest possible customer experience, with best-in-class engineering support.


 


About the Role:


As a part of Charter Business Architecture Practice team, the Junior Business Architect is an entry-level role responsible for BA projects delivery according to the Charter’s methodologies in place. This includes participating in the client-facing engagements, creating essential deliverables such as business capability models, personas, journey maps and value streams.



With previous  experience in business architecture or related fields, exposure to corporate or public sector environments, a relevant bachelor’s degree, and practical experience in business process mapping and documentation, the Junior Business Architect  will also contribute to the Charter BA Practice development and Charter’s work with clients that is aimed to bridge the gap between technology and business at a foundational level.



Responsibilities:



  • Conduct customer and industry research and ensure information remains accurate and relevant

  • Develop key business architecture artifacts such as stakeholder maps, personas, journey maps, and process models

  • Support and document stakeholder workshops and interviews

  • Present clear, concise recommendations and solutions focused on key messages

  • Coordinate customer engagements with project teams, Account Managers, and other practices

  • Maintain accurate project documentation, customer data, and the BA repository

  • Contribute to business development, sales insights, and overall practice growth

  • Build and enhance business capability models aligned with maturity frameworks and long‑term roadmaps

  • Create thought leadership content including case studies, blogs, and whitepapers while managing priorities effectively

  • Collaborate with delivery teams and architects, support capability development discussions, and participate in training and practice initiatives




Required Qualifications and Experience:



  • 1-3 years of proven experience in business architecture roles or previous experience in consulting, business analysis, process improvement, or IT-related roles

  • Previous exposure to corporate or public environment

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Information Technology, Computer Science, or a related field.

  • Hands-on experience mapping, analyzing, and documenting business processes using frameworks like BPM

  • TOGAF Architecture Certified or available to undertake a certification path to achieve in 6 - 9 months



  • Design Thinking Certificate is an asset

  • Other complementary professional certifications are considered an asset.



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:



  • Strong situational analysis and critical thinking skills

  • Experience supporting client interviews and engagement sessions, translating insights into actionable outcomes

  • Ability to actively listen, ask clarifying questions, and distill complex information

  • Experience assisting with workshop facilitation, including preparation and documentation of outcomes

  • Effective collaborator across all levels of an organization

  • Strong written, verbal, and visual communication skills tailored to different audiences

  • Commitment to continuous learning through ongoing professional development

  • Broad enterprise perspective across strategy, processes, capabilities, technology, and governance

  • Experience modelling business processes using various tools and techniques

  • Familiarity with industry frameworks (e.g., BABOK, DMBOK, ITIL, PMBOK, ADKAR, LEAN) and awareness of industry trends and best practices



Working Conditions:



  • Full time role involving travels

  • Overtime may be required

  • Hybrid work model, or fully remote with some travels required as needed



  • Travel :





    • Minimal travel may be required, 5-10%, within Canada

    • Must have valid driver’s license
